The Need for Integration
As businesses strive to deliver personalized and cohesive experiences to their customers, the integration of marketing automation and customer relationship management (CRM) systems has become imperative. Marketo, as a robust marketing automation platform, empowers organizations to automate and measure marketing engagement, while Salesforce serves as a versatile CRM solution for managing customer relationships and sales processes. By integrating these two platforms, businesses can bridge the gap between marketing and sales, creating a unified ecosystem for lead management, customer engagement, and sales pipeline optimization.
The integration of Marketo and Salesforce enables a synchronized approach to data management, lead qualification, and campaign tracking, leading to greater efficiency, accuracy, and alignment between marketing and sales teams. With a comprehensive understanding of customer behavior, interests, and engagement, businesses can deliver highly targeted and personalized marketing campaigns, driving enhanced lead generation and revenue growth.
Streamlining Processes and Enhancing Insights
One of the key advantages of integrating Marketo and Salesforce lies in the ability to streamline processes and gain valuable insights that drive informed decision-making. By unifying marketing and sales data within a single integrated platform, businesses can achieve greater visibility into customer interactions, campaign performance, and sales pipeline progression. This holistic view enables marketing and sales teams to collaborate more effectively, aligning their efforts to nurture leads, close deals, and maximize customer lifetime value.
Through the integration of Marketo and Salesforce, businesses can automate lead capturing, scoring, and nurturing processes, ensuring that sales representatives are equipped with high-quality leads and actionable insights. Furthermore, the seamless transfer of lead data between Marketo and Salesforce facilitates a closed-loop feedback mechanism, enabling marketers to track the success of their campaigns and attribute revenue to specific marketing initiatives. This level of data integration and visibility empowers businesses to optimize their marketing strategies and allocate resources more efficiently, driving better ROI and business outcomes.

Challenges and Best Practices
While the benefits of integrating Marketo and Salesforce are substantial, businesses should be mindful of the complexities and challenges that come with such integration. Data governance, system alignment, and process synchronization are critical aspects that require careful planning, execution, and ongoing maintenance. Ensuring data accuracy, consistency, and compliance across both platforms is essential for leveraging the full potential of integration while mitigating potential risks.
To achieve successful integration, businesses should adhere to best practices such as establishing clear data mapping and synchronization rules, defining lead management processes, and implementing robust data quality measures. Collaboration between marketing and sales teams is also pivotal, as alignment and communication are fundamental to maximizing the impact of integrated efforts.
